so i have a 2000 xj with LP Dana 30.it has all new u joints and unit bearings and a spartan.one reason i want to swap for a high pinion is my pinion bearing is about shot.My father in law has a 95 parts jeep with a hp.can i gut my axle ( unit bearing axles with the bigger u joints and my locker and put new seals in the donnor ?will it all fit?i also have the stupid pre cats ,will this be a problem? thanks for any info. oh what about drive shaft length and any thing else im overlooking ?

Unit bearings won't work. Everything else should swap over though. Some run into issues with the pre cats, if you you're lifted it should be better though.
